Care homes in County Durham

There are 146 care homes registered with the CQC in County Durham, North East. 57 are nursing homes and 94 are registered for dementia care. 10 are rated Outstanding and 123 Good by the CQC.

Of the 4 homes with a fee on record, the typical residential fee is £1,193 a week, with the middle half of homes charging £1,177 to £1,210. Nursing care is typically £1,406 a week. A live-in carer at home costs from about £1,120 a week and can look after a couple.

Will the council pay for a care home in County Durham?

If your savings and assets are below £23,250 the council will assess what you can afford and may pay part or all of the fee. Contact the adult social care team at the council for a needs assessment.
